Abstract

A semiconductor device comprises a semiconductor substrate containing silicon as a constituent element, an impurity diffused layer formed in a predetermined region of the semiconductor substrate, an underlayer oxide film formed on the surface of the semiconductor substrate, an Al-Si alloy interconnection electrically connected to the impurity diffused layer through a contact hole and formed in a predetermined region on the underlayer insulating film, and an antireflection coating comprising a layer of an Al-Si-Sb alloy or a layer of an Al-Si-Sn alloy formed on the alloy interconnection.
